In Taking Steps: A Grandfather and Grandson’s Journey , Stephan Ray Swimmer delivers a moving blend of narrative storytelling and endurance training philosophy rooted in Native American traditions. When a troubled young boy finds himself lost in grief, incarceration, and despair, a surprising opportunity emerges through the guidance of his estranged grandfather—a legendary Native American running coach. Together, they embark on a transformative journey combining spiritual healing, cultural heritage, and a rigorous training regimen inspired by ancient wisdom and modern science. From running trails to tribal rituals, the book outlines a path not just to athletic greatness, but to emotional and spiritual redemption. This inspiring story offers more than a personal tale—it provides practical training advice, holistic fitness strategies, and motivational tools tailored especially for Native American athletes, families, and communities looking to reclaim identity and wellness through endurance sports.
